Effektivt formulerade krav får utvecklingslaget att starta springande. Tyvärr innebär kravdokumentationen ofta att laget får börja med att ta reda på vad kraven egentligen betyder och snarast kryper ur startgroparna. I traditionell systemutveckling kan detta problem gömma sig under en lång utvecklingscykel, men för den som tillämpar metoder a la agile såsom Scrum blir problemet smärtsamt tydligt.
Två angreppssätt som i kombination visat sig vara förvånansvärt effektiva är en hård fokus på konceptualisering och domänmodellering enligt Domain Driven Design tillsammans med det story-format med konkretiserade scenarior som förespråkas av Behaviour Driven Development. Angreppssätten kan även med fördel användas för att förstärka eller komplettera andra kravformat, som till exempel use-case i RUP.
Under denna heldagskurs arbetar vi med ett konkret exempel för att diskutera nyckefrågor och upptäcka fallgropar samt hur dessa kan undvikas. I exemplet inför vi ett krav i taget, arbetar aktivt med att formulera om det på ett kärnfullt sätt, reviderar om modellen behöver förändras, och fortsätter med nästa krav. Under resans gång berör vi flera nyckelfrågor och upparbetar en liten checklista att använda vid kravformulering.
Vi ser även hur detta knyter ihop hela utvecklingscykeln från tidig kravformulering till slutgiltig acceptanstest.
Efter denna kurs kommer dina krav aldrig att bli sig lika igen.
Mer information om kursen finner du här Detaljerad kursbeskrivning (pdf)
Frågor eller funderingar kring kursen?
Kontakta sales@omegapoint.se